Thought I'd post the spec:
Pioneer continue their highly acclaimed series of DVD writers with the DVR-112. As with the 111 series, drives that have the "D" suffix (DVR-112D version) indicates that it won't write DVD-RAM discs, but the this DVR-112 writer will. Both drives will read RAM discs.
There are 6 main differences to the DVR-112D compared to the previous 111 series
# DVD+/-R writing speed is increased to 18x
# Dual/Double Layer writing speed is increased to 10x
# DVD-RAM writing speed is increased to 12x
# Performance Adjusting Firmware - automatically optimises the disc?s rotation speed depending on the user?s application ? for example, if watching a movie or listening to music, the disc velocity is reduced in order to keep background noise to a minimum
# Multi-effect Liquid Crystal Tilt Compensator - further improves recording and playback characteristics by compensating for discs that are warped or of uneven thickness (operates at high speeds and with Dual/Double layer discs)
# Ultra-DRA (Dynamic Rosonance Absober) - suppresses vibration caused by imbalanced discs. Disc-Resonance Stabiliser - controls the airflow generated by the disc-rotation to minimise disc-warping effect that can occur when a disc rotates at high speed.
Price:?20.99
Pioneer drives are the ones we always recommend as the mainstream writers least likely to cause their owners problems. Choice of bezel colours also lets you match the writer colour to your PC chassis (Beige / Black / Silver)
These drives have standard ATAPI interfaces (not SATA) but require 80-wire cables. These drives are also compliant with Reduction of Hazardous Substances (RoHS) regulations
The color of this drives bezel is BEIGE
Specifications:
# Max 18x Writing Speed for DVD-R/-R
# Max 10x Writing Speed for DVD-R DL/+R DL (Dual/Double Layer Media)
# Max 8x Writing Speed for DVD+RW
# Max 6x Writing Speed for DVD-RW
# Max 12x Writing speed for DVD-Ram
# Max 40x Writing Speed for CD-R
# Max 32x Writing Speed for CD-RW
# Reads DVD-ROM, DVD-VIDEO, DVD-R, DVD-RW, DVD+R, DVD+RW, DVD+R DL, DVD-R DL & DVD-RAM
# Reads CD-ROM (Mode1 & 2), CD-ROM XA, CD Audio, Video CD, PhotoCD, CD EXTRA, CD-Text, CD-R, CD-RW
# Disc-At-Once and Incremental Recording (multi-border) on DVDs
# Disc/Track/Session-At-Once and Packet Recording (multi-border) on CDs
# Multi Effect LCD Tilt Served Compensator Mechanism
# Ultra-DRA (Dynamic Resonance Absorber) Low Vibration Mechanism
# Performance adjusting firmware
# Disc Resonance Stabiliser
# Data Buffer Size: 2mb
# Interfaces as an ATAPI device (ATA-5 & SFF-8090)
# IDE Data Transfer of PIO Mode 4, Multi Word DMA Mode 2, Ultra DMA Mode 2, and Ultra DMA Mode 4 (UDMA 66)
